易语言https post证书
时间 : 2024-11-28 23:00:01 浏览量 : 71
《易语言 HTTPs Post 证书:保障安全数据传输的关键》
在当今数字化时代,网络安全至关重要,而 HTTPs(超文本传输安全协议)及其相关的证书在保障数据安全传输方面发挥着不可替代的作用。对于易语言开发者来说,理解和掌握 HTTPs Post 证书的相关知识更是尤为关键。
HTTPs 是在 HTTP 协议基础上加入了 SSL/TLS 加密层,通过使用证书来验证服务器的身份,并对传输的数据进行加密,防止数据在传输过程中被窃取、篡改或伪造。易语言作为一种常用的编程语言,能够方便地实现 HTTPs Post 操作,借助证书来确保数据的安全传输。
易语言中的 HTTPs Post 证书通常采用数字证书的形式,这些证书由受信任的证书颁发机构(CA)签发。当客户端与服务器建立 HTTPS 连接时,服务器会向客户端提供其证书,客户端会验证该证书的合法性和有效性。如果证书合法,客户端就可以与服务器建立安全的连接,并进行数据的交互。
在使用易语言进行 HTTPs Post 操作时,首先需要获取并安装相应的证书。开发者可以从受信任的 CA 机构获取证书,或者使用内部的证书颁发系统。获取证书后,需要将其导入到易语言的开发环境中,并在代码中进行相应的配置。
以下是一个简单的易语言 HTTPs Post 示例代码,展示了如何使用证书进行数据传输:
```e
.版本 2
.支持库 Internet
.局部变量 http, HTTP 请求对象
.局部变量 postData, 文本型
.局部变量 response, 文本型
' 创建 HTTP 请求对象
http.创建 ("https://example.com/api")
' 设置证书
http.设置安全证书 ("证书路径", "密码")
' 设置 POST 数据
postData = "param1=value1¶m2=value2"
' 发送 POST 请求并获取响应
response = http.发送数据 (postData, #HTTP 数据类型_表单数据)
' 输出响应内容
调试输出 (response)
```
在上述代码中,首先创建了一个 HTTP 请求对象,然后设置了证书路径和密码。接着,设置了要发送的 POST 数据,并使用发送数据方法发送请求并获取响应。输出响应内容。
需要注意的是,在使用 HTTPs Post 证书时,要确保证书的合法性和安全性。选择受信任的 CA 机构颁发的证书,并定期更新证书,以防止证书被攻击或过期。同时,要注意保护证书的机密性,避免证书被泄露或被盗用。
易语言 HTTPs Post 证书是保障安全数据传输的重要组成部分。通过正确使用证书,开发者可以在易语言中实现安全的 HTTPs Post 操作,保护用户的隐私和数据安全。在开发过程中,要充分了解证书的相关知识,并遵循安全最佳实践,以确保系统的安全性和可靠性。